Even better, with a Condrieu-like profile of caramelized citrus, apricot, flower oil and tangerine, the 2013 Borrowed (Roussanne, Chardonnay, Marsanne and a splash of Viognier) is full-bodied, rich, unctuous and concentrated. Possessing low acidity, it should evolve gracefully on its dry extract and concentration. It’s a seriously good white.

Jeb Dunnuck - Wine Advocate (92)
